hello SDVblr!! Im calculating the ‘real life’ birthdays of the bachelor/ettes :)
I’ve been wanting to celebrate my faves bday but ‘Fall 5’ doesn’t work irl very well.. — and celebrating every sdv bday on the first month of the given season isnt ideal!! sooo i was thinking about pulling out the sdv season months into real seasons!
So, i did the math and if we go on a regular non-leap year, these are the days in the seasons:
Winter: 90
Spring: 92
Summer: 92
Autumn: 91
To keep it easy to understand, we’ll round it all down to 90 days — this works better because there are no birthdays on the 28th. So we need to pull 28 days outwards into 90 days. This is ALMOST perfectly 30, so each sdv day will get pulled out by 3!
this is how I’ve sorted it. this is 90 columns, separated into 28 coloured days (obviously it doesn’t fit perfectly, so the 28th day is one day short, but this is fine since no sdv bdays)
now, obviously, we need to sort birthdays into these new extended days. There’s really no ‘proper’ mathematical way to do this, so my method was:
For each sdv season, assign the irl month categories their months (dec/jan/feb for winter, etc)
Count up to bachelor/ette’s birthday in the sdv days, the coloured segments
Then, count from their last digit inside the sdv day to find their irl day (think, if someone’s birthday was 16th, I’d count 6 times in one of the coloured segments, and go back to the first day column when it got to the last day column. Confusing, but effective!)
Whichever irl month their number landed in from 1-30/31-60/61-90, that would be their bday month, and counting inside of that month would be the day (42nd overall = 12th in second month)
And done!!! Put the number and the month together and you’ve got a irl-converted bday :)
